Engine 2 and Medic 2 stationed at Central Fire Headquarters were dispatched to a person in labor. Upon arrival crews determined there was not time for transport and assisted in the immediate delivery of a healthy baby. Mom and baby are doing great and paid a visit to the firehouse today to thank and celebrate with the personal that were onscene that day. Chief Czentnar presents the crews with a stork pin.

The Wallingford Fire and Police departments staged a motor vehicle accident at Sheehan High School this past Thursday. It shows the reality of driving while impaired. Many departments do this prior to proms to hopefully deliver the message of what can happen if driving while impaired. Multiple companies used hydraulic and battery powered rescue tools to remove the doors and roofs of vehicles to gain access to the victims to treat and transport via ground ambulance or Lifestar helicopter.

Did you remember to change your clocks today? Take a few minutes to change the batteries in your smoke and CO detectors. Also if the detector is older than 5 years you should think about replacing it. Check with the manufacturer of your alarm, as alot are now sealed 10 year units. (From date of manufacture on unit, not install date)

1/27/22 @ 14:51 the WFD was dispatched to this Windswept Hill Rd residence for a reported fire. On Arrival Engine 1 reported smoke showing from the rear and the roof. Upon a 360, heavy fire was showing from the rear picture window and through the roof. Engine 1 advanced a line to extinguish fire and the truck cut the roof. Engine 3 assisted in laddering the building and advancing a back up line to the second floor while searching. The fire was contained to the family room. There was major interior damage from smoke and heat from the fire. This fire was located in a non hydranted part of town, so tankers setup portable ponds for water supply. One person was home at the time of the fire and was not injured. No firefighter injuries were reported. The FMO is investigating fire. The following units responded. E1, E3, E2, E8, Sq8 Tanker 8, Tanker 7, Car 4 and Car 2. Medic 1 and Medic 2. Meriden FD for RIT and North Branford Tanker 3 for additional tanker.

At 2:31AM on 1/29/22 during the beginning of the blizzard the WFD was called out for this house fire-Engine 3 reported fire from 2nd floor window on arrival. The fire was under control fairly quickly. Crews remained on scene to overhaul and assist the FMO who is investigating. Career Units along with volunteer units responded-Meriden FD for RIT.
